Transaction 8606a4951981cad001dc74b613bc9e37c3d73a836364f0ca330c8c8ade705e03
1 Input
1 Output
-
8606a4951981cad001dc74b613bc9e37c3d73a836364f0ca330c8c8ade705e03:0
- value
- 2459225
- script pubkey
- OP_0 OP_PUSHBYTES_20 ef8de413338053769bfd6a6413dddcf61c3e7f32
- address
- bc1qa7x7gyenspfhdxladfjp8hwu7cwrulejxlvhgm